簡介

In this new addition to the Knowledge Essentials series, Kindergarten Success shows you how to enrich your child's classroom learning and take an active role in your kindergarten’s education by exploring: What your child is learning at school and the educational standards to expect in math, language arts, science, and social studies—as well as the developmental skills expected of your kindergartener Your child's learning style—visual, auditory, or kinesthetic— and how it affects the way your child learns and processes information Hundreds of easy-to-do activities designed to help your child meet specific learning requirements Environmental learning sections that identify learning opportunities in the everyday world Methods and checklists to assess your child's progress The developmental and social changes expected of your kindergartener as well as information on how to determine readiness to move up to the first grade Recommendations of age-appropriate books and software that will enhance learning
